Abstract
Glutamic acid diacetic acid (GLDA) is a new generation of chelating agent that can be used as alternative to EDTA (ethylenediaminetetraacetate) and phosphonates, especially in cleaning applications.

Description of Substitution
Introduction Chelates are chemical agents that interact or complex with metal ions as well as hard water ions such as Ca2+, Mg2+. Some common chelating agents used in industrial cleaning compounds include EDTA (ethylenediaminetetraacetate) or phosphates. Unfortunately, EDTA is not readily biodegradable and phosphates can cause pollution via eutrophication and are therefore not environmentally friendly. L-GLDA (glutamic acid diacetic acid) is an easily biodegradable chelating agent (>60 percent degrades within 28 days), that fulfills the performance of traditional chelating agents such as EDTA. It is made of the naturally occurring L-glutamic acid coming from sugar, molasses, corn or rice. It has very good ecological and toxicological properties. According to the Swedish Society for Nature Conservation it is based on 86 percent natural and renewable materials. It has high water solubility over a wide pH range and retains its high chelating value at elevated temperatures more than other chelating agents. In cleaning formulations and under harsh washing conditions, GLDA complexes hard water ions very well and shows good stain removing properties with tea, starch, meat and burnt milk stains. GLDA is produced by Akzo Nobel and denoted as Dissolvine® GL.
